Efficient workflows in Mechanical, Electrical, and Plumbing (MEP) engineering depend heavily on how quickly you can access and place accurate Building Information Modeling (BIM) families. Managing thousands of components—from duct fittings to switchboards—can overwhelm local servers and stall projects.

A link is only as good as the organization behind it. If your MEP folder is a dumped mess of unorganized files, your team will abandon it. Structure your centralized library logically by discipline and category: Air Handling Units (AHUs) Duct Accessories (Dampers, Louvers) Air Terminals (Diffusers, Grilles) Fans & Blowers 02_Electrical Switchgear & Panels Lighting Fixtures (Interior & Exterior) Data & Communication (Server racks, jacks) Conduit & Cable Tray Fittings 03_Plumbing & Fire Protection Fixtures (Sinks, Toilets, Showers) Equipment (Water Heaters, Pumps) Pipe Accessories (Valves, Strainers) Sprinkler Heads & Fire Cabinets 04_Details & Annotation 2D Drafting Views Custom MEP Tags and Symbols Advanced BIM Workflows: Moving Beyond Network Folders
